Pheromones are compound secreted by the females of many insect species to attract males. one of these compounds contains 80.78 percent C, 13.56 percent H, 5.66 percent O. A solution of 1.19 g of this pheromone in 7.23 g of benzene freezes at 2.52 Celsius. What are the molecular formula and molar mass of the compound?
(The normal freezing point of pure benzene is 5.5 Celsius)
